Why we picked it

Let's be honest, we're all drowning in a sea of gadgets that promise to make our lives better, yet somehow, here I am, still searching for that elusive spark of joy. Enter the LEGO Ideas Typewriter, a glorious reminder of simpler times where a satisfying 'clack' and the sight of ink on paper ruled the world. This isn't just a building set; it's a ticket to the past that also doubles as a quirky conversation starter, or at the very least, a splendid way to show off to your mates how 'artsy' you are.

With its impressive attention to detail, this set effortlessly earns the title of Hero pick. It's like someone took the charm of vintage typewriters, sprinkled in a bit of nostalgia, and wrapped it all in LEGO bricks. To think I was only after a good distraction from adulting!

Let's face it, not all of us can actually write that next great novel, but with this stunning piece on our desk, we can at least pretend we're working towards it while we pen our shopping lists. Talk about killing two birds with one beautifully crafted brick!

The Irresistible

  • The delightful nostalgia factor-every click transports me back to simpler days.
  • It's a conversation piece that even your non-LEGO friends admire (shock horror).
  • The building experience is surprisingly therapeutic; who knew connecting bricks could be a form of adulting?!

The Clever Part

  • Perfect for creative souls who enjoy a bit of DIY with a retro twist.
  • Collectible as it is functional-like owning a slice of design history but in plastic.
  • The typewriter keys actually move when you press them, turning this into an interactive display model.

The Fine Print

  • Can we talk about the amount of time required to build? I lost track somewhere around bag 7.
  • Lego pieces tend to wander off, meaning I had to conduct a rather sad treasure hunt between the sofa cushions.
  • Be prepared for the inevitable questions from friends asking why you own a LEGO typewriter-explain that one!

The Reality Check

  • Not exactly travel-friendly-this beauty will have to sit proudly on your desk, gathering all the 'oohs' and 'aahs'.
  • One small spillage of coffee will ruin its aesthetic appeal-trust me, I speak from experience!
